Two separate incidents of students falling ill after consuming mid-day meals have been reported in India. In Telangana===Sangareddy district, Telangana, 22 students were hospitalized after eating sambar and rice, experiencing stomach pain and discomfort. All are reported to be in stable condition and expected to be discharged. In a separate incident near Tamil Nadu===Coimbatore, Tamil Nadu, 33 students from Odakkalpalayam Government Middle School fell ill with similar symptoms after their mid-day meal. These students were admitted to various hospitals including Aram Hospital, Purushothaman Hospital, and Royal Care Hospital. Authorities in both regions, including Telangana===Narayankhed police and Tamil Nadu===Sultanpet Block Development Officer, have launched investigations into the cause of the illnesses and are monitoring the situation. These events have renewed concerns over food safety and the monitoring of the mid-day meal scheme in government schools across India.
